Arizona Diamondbacks
Optioned IFs Alex Cintron and Junior Spivey and OFs Jason Conti
and Jack Cust to Tucson (AAA).
ORACLE SAYS: The Diamondbacks are rapidly reaching
the point at which they?ll have to make a decision on what to do with Jack Cust.?
He didn?t hit quite as well in 2000 as he did in the past and the team was publicly
very upset with Cust when he left winter league ball after playing terribly.?
I wouldn?t be surprised to see Cust end up in another organization if Arizona
is around .500 at the All-Star break and nobody?s running away with the NL West.

Cincinnati Reds
Optioned Ps Keith Glauber, Jim Brower and Ed Yarnall to Louisville
(AAA).
Optioned Ps Leo Estrella and Brian Reith and OFs Adam Dunn and
Austin Kearns to Chattanooga (AA).
ORACLE SAYS: Kearns is one to watch for the next
few years.? If he hits at Chattanooga as well as he hit for Dayton in 2000,
even Bob Boone won?t be able to stop him from getting a job.? Kearns has a very
strong arm and the organization is happy with his progress.? Yarnall had his
2000 ruined by back problems and has apparently lost his bid for a rotation
job.? He?ll be back, though.

Houston Astros
Assigned Ps Carlos Hernandez, Jim Mann, Roy Oswalt, Brian Powell
and Wilfredo Rodriguez; Cs Raul Chavez and Carlos Maldonado; IF Aaron McNeal
and OF Omar Ramirez to minor league camp.
ORACLE SAYS: Most of these reductions were expected.?
A lot is expected of Oswalt in the future and I think the Astros are going to
get it.?? Dominated the Texas League, striking out 141 in 129.2 innings while
only allowing 106 hits, 22 walks, and 5 home runs.
